The Wind River Range (or "Winds" for short) is a mountain range of the Rocky Mountains located in Wyoming and runs for approximately 100 miles The Wind River’s Gannett Peak at 13,804 feet is Wyoming's highest peak. In fact, 19 of Wyoming’s 20 highest peaks are in the Wind River Range. 

Much of the Wind River Range received federal protection as National Forest Primitive Areas in 1931–32. The Wind River Range is now largely protected by three federal wilderness areas.  Together these wilderness areas protect 728,020 acres making the Wind River Range one of the largest road-free areas in the continental United States. Part of the eastern slope of the Wind River Range is also under the protection of the Wind River Indian Reservation.

Several major rivers have headwaters on either side of the range. The Green and Big Sandy Rivers drain southward from the west side of the range, while the Wind River drains eastward through the Shoshone Basin. The Green is the largest fork of the Colorado River while the Wind River where it changes to Bighorn River, is the largest fork of the Yellowstone River. The range includes several canyons on either side, including Silas Canyon and Sinks Canyon. The canyons are carved by rivers such as the Middle Fork of the Popo Agie which feeds the Wind River. 

The Winds are home to one ski area, White Pine.  It is the only lift-accessible skiing and snowboarding area in the range and is the oldest ski area in Wyoming.

Candle Care Tips

  • Never leave a burning candle unattended. Extinguish all candles when you leave a room or before going to sleep. We recommend burning for a maximum of 4 hours each time you enjoy your candle.
  • Follow the 2-foot rule. Don't place a burning candle within 2 feet of clothing, books, curtains, or other flammable objects.
  • Keep lit candles away from drafts, ceiling fans, and any air currents. This keeps the flame burning steadily in the center of the candle.
  • Trim the wick to ¼” before every burn. This helps prevent the flame from getting too large, and also cuts down on any excess soot.
  • Keep candles out of the reach of children and pets.
  • When burning multiple candles at once, always place them at least 3 inches apart from each other.
  • A burning candle should never be used as a nightlight. Always extinguish any lit candles before going to sleep.
  • A candle should not be burned for more than four hours at a time, exceeding this could cause safety issues.

How It's Made

Precision and Passion: Every Candle Perfected

Each candle is thoughtfully created with superior products. Before we introduce our new collections, we thoroughly test each candle type and recipe.  We conduct multiple burn tests, ensuring the right wicks and fragrance amounts are being used, and confirm the candle is performing as it should. 

The Perfect Candle Awaits After a Two-Week Cure

Once all tests are passed, we create your candle!  We then let the candle cure for 2 weeks. This allows the candle to harden, improving the melt pool while it burns. This also allows the fragrance to be distributed throughout the candle, binding to the wax, and improving the overall scent. 

Once cured, another quality check is performed, and we prepare the candle to present to you.
